Ductwork & Ventilation

When the Ducts Are the Problem

In communities like Oak Creek, Westpark, and Quail Hill — where homes were built in the 1990s and early 2000s — ductwork is now old enough to develop leaks, gaps at joints, and insulation breakdown that pulls unconditioned air (and whatever is in your attic or wall cavities) directly into your living space. Shalom's duct inspection process identifies these failure points before they become a health or efficiency issue. We use duct sealing and targeted repairs to restore system integrity, and where ductwork is beyond repair, we handle full duct replacement coordinated with the City of Irvine's building department — which runs its own permitting and inspection process independently of the county. Properly sealed ducts don't just improve air quality; they also reduce the load on your HVAC system and lower energy use. Call (714) 886-2021 to get a duct inspection scheduled.

Irvine Neighborhoods & IAQ

Neighborhood-Specific IAQ Considerations

Not every Irvine community has the same indoor air quality profile. Shady Canyon and Turtle Rock sit closer to open hillside terrain near Irvine Regional Park and the Turtle Rock Nature Center, where seasonal wind events push fine particulates into homes that may not have adequate filtration. The high-density attached-unit communities near Irvine Spectrum and Cypress Village face different challenges — shared HVAC infrastructure and limited natural ventilation mean that one unit's air quality problem can become a neighbor's. Meanwhile, the newer Great Park Neighborhoods and Woodbury areas feature modern construction with tighter building envelopes that, while energy-efficient, require deliberate mechanical ventilation strategies to avoid stale, recirculated air. Shalom's approach is always site-specific: we look at your community's construction type, your system's current condition, and your household's actual needs before recommending a solution. How long does it take to install an indoor air quality system in an Irvine home?
Most standalone IAQ upgrades — such as a whole-home air purifier, UV light, or humidifier integrated with your existing HVAC — can be completed in a single visit, typically a few hours. More involved work like duct sealing, duct replacement, or an energy recovery ventilator installation may take a full day or require a follow-up visit depending on the home's layout. My Irvine home near Great Park Neighborhoods feels stuffy even with the AC running — is that an air quality issue or an HVAC problem?
Stuffiness in newer, tightly sealed homes like those in Great Park Neighborhoods is often a ventilation issue rather than a cooling failure — the system is conditioning the same recirculated air without bringing in enough fresh outdoor air. An energy recovery ventilator or a fresh-air intake upgrade can resolve this without sacrificing energy efficiency.
